in the info card I'm also gonna share common sense vers common action like for
example it's common sense that should go to the gym
it's common sense I could actually quit smoking right it's common sense that
people should go to therapy it's common sense that people should meditate like
common sense doesn't do you any good it's the action that you have to take so
because I hear this all the time I worked in treatment centers I work with
people of trying to overcome a big scene the struggle with mental illness and
they're always like I know I know I know I don't care I don't care how much you
know and I'm talking to you watching this I don't care how many books you
read how much knowledge you have in your brain if you're not doing anything
with it then what's the point common sense verse common action and by the way
